如何用Python做一个骰子模拟器和石头剪刀布游戏
发表于:2024-11-24 作者:千家信息网编辑
千家信息网最后更新 2024年11月24日,这篇"如何用Python做一个骰子模拟器和石头剪刀布游戏"文章的知识点大部分人都不太理解,所以小编给大家总结了以下内容,内容详细,步骤清晰,具有一定的借鉴价值,希望大家阅读完这篇文章能有所收获,下面我
千家信息网最后更新 2024年11月24日如何用Python做一个骰子模拟器和石头剪刀布游戏
这篇"如何用Python做一个骰子模拟器和石头剪刀布游戏"文章的知识点大部分人都不太理解,所以小编给大家总结了以下内容,内容详细,步骤清晰,具有一定的借鉴价值,希望大家阅读完这篇文章能有所收获,下面我们一起来看看这篇"如何用Python做一个骰子模拟器和石头剪刀布游戏"文章吧。
一、骰子模拟器
目标:做出一个可以掷骰子游戏的程序。
tips:在用户询问时,用 random 模块去生成 1 到 6 间的数字。
二、石头剪刀布游戏
目标:做出一个命令行游戏,玩家可以在石头、剪刀和布之间选择,和计算机进行对决。如果玩家获胜,得分会添加,游戏结束后最终分数展示给玩家。
tops:收到玩家选择,和计算机选择比较。计算机的选择是在列表随机选中。如果玩家获胜会增加一分。
import randomchoices = ["Rock", "Paper", "Scissors"]computer = random.choice(choices)player = Falsecpu_score = 0player_score = 0while True: player = input("Rock, Paper or Scissors?").capitalize() # 判断游戏者和电脑的选择 if player == computer: print("Tie!") elif player == "Rock": if computer == "Paper": print("You lose!", computer, "covers", player) cpu_score+=1 else: print("You win!", player, "smashes", computer) player_score+=1 elif player == "Paper": if computer == "Scissors": print("You lose!", computer, "cut", player) cpu_score+=1 else: print("You win!", player, "covers", computer) player_score+=1 elif player == "Scissors": if computer == "Rock": print("You lose...", computer, "smashes", player) cpu_score+=1 else: print("You win!", player, "cut", computer) player_score+=1 elif player=='E': print("Final Scores:") print(f"CPU:{cpu_score}") print(f"Plaer:{player_score}") break else: print("That's not a valid play. Check your spelling!") computer = random.choice(choices)
以上就是关于"如何用Python做一个骰子模拟器和石头剪刀布游戏"这篇文章的内容,相信大家都有了一定的了解,希望小编分享的内容对大家有帮助,若想了解更多相关的知识内容,请关注行业资讯频道。
石头
骰子
内容
玩家
选择
模拟器
刀布
计算机
文章
目标
知识
篇文章
之间
价值
分数
剪刀
命令
大部分
就是
得分
数据库的安全要保护哪些东西
数据库安全各自的含义是什么
生产安全数据库录入
数据库的安全性及管理
数据库安全策略包含哪些
海淀数据库安全审计系统
建立农村房屋安全信息数据库
易用的数据库客户端支持安全管理
连接数据库失败ssl安全错误
数据库的锁怎样保障安全
网络安全法规定条例
我与网络安全征文一年级
北京苹果软件开发公司有哪些
湖南pdu服务器专用电源哪家强
茂名幼儿师范网络安全
合肥兴尘网络技术有限公司
机房网络安全设备需要哪些
台州大数据库安全
北京软件开发网络培训班
shell长连接数据库
三级网络技术nat
广东移动服务器云主机
一些物理化学常用的数据库
网络安全再多
中国网络技术公司扣钱
攻击服服务器教程
京东软件开发工资水平
scrapy 多网页数据库
计算机网络安全的影响因素
ac数据库
腾讯饥荒开服务器教程
饥荒服务器中途加棱镜
传完值后请空数据库
数据库管理模块
数据库及检索式
网络安全再多
高密度无线网络技术
食品安全与网络安全的心得体会
鸠鸠互联网科技安全吗
链接服务器超时apex